Khan and Sky bullsh*t

Post by WildWaylon »

"This is a big step up for me" says Khan. What total bullshit, how can it be. Once you have peeled off the top layer of this guys record you can see he has just knocked out bums. If he was really any good he would be in the top 20. Sky say "19 fights 19 wins 17 KOs, both men unbeaten, who will lose their unbeaton record". Khan replies "and it wont be me". Utter shite to sell the fight to the public who know even less than we do about two jabs Prescott. Even the Sky team big the fight up to make it look like its a tough one for Khan. This is a step backwards and should be an easy win for Khan. If it isnt then Khan is going nowhere in boxing. The only test is fighting someone taller than him for a change. When Khan wins easily the average fan will think Khan is fantastic beating a previously undefeated fighter with a huge KO record. The whole thing is a joke!!!

Re: Khan and Sky bullsh*t

Post by Wax On »

I've just been down the pub with a few mates and a couple said they were buying this on PPV.

They know little about boxing, but like Khan and enjoy watching his fights.

It really hit home to me that sky will get plenty of buys for this, from people like my mates who don't know enough about boxing to consider this a mismatch because of the Amir Khan name / brand and the way that Sky market the fight.

It's daylight robbery really, but for every boxing anorak who comes on here and won't buy it, theres probably 100 passive boxing fans who might.

Re: Khan and Sky bullsh*t

Post by Goz »

The Sky marketing machine is sickening me like never before.

They are running an ad on the radio where they reel off highlights from Darke and Lennon Jnr saying names like "Iron Mike Tyson, Lennox Lewis, Naseem Hamed" then "Amir Khan" :-?

Sound ludicrous to me but as you say to the very casual boxing fan they have elavated Khan to that level by association - they now think they are watching a fight of real significance up there with some real glory glory nights.

It's shameless.

When you think what trade descriptions come down on companies for - Sky are getting away with murder here.
